Product Description

by Roy C. Raisor (Author)

Roy Raisor signed up to go to Vietnam before he was even eighteen years old, proudly intending to serve his country and do his patriotic duty. Like many of the young men that served in the Vietnam War, he came face-to-face with a situation entirely different than what he expected.

Inside, you will find the story of Roy's time in Vietnam through a first-hand account of his experiences. Written even for those that don't have a military background or much knowledge of the War itself, Roy tells of battles and what really happened on the front lines. He tells all of the good and the bad, and introduces us to some of the men that became life- long brothers-in-arms. He also addresses how PTSD and loss has shaped him into the man he is today. Through his story, you may come to the same understanding that, truly, no one came home unwounded.
